Quick note for plugin folks: PerchWiki's role engine runs as its own service, so your plugin never touches ACLs directly — call the grants endpoint instead. Spin up the sandbox with make sandbox, then copy env.dev into place. The grants endpoint checks a shared service credential on every call, so add this line to your env file first.

sealed setting: RELAY_SECRET5=82864

# Partner SFTP drop configuration for the Quillhaven intake pipeline.
# Files from partner orgs land in the drop directory nightly around 02:00;
# the poller moves them into staging for parsing. If support sees stalled
# imports, check poller logs first — nine times out of ten the partner
# uploaded a zero-byte file. Host and port settings live below; do not
# change the polling interval without clearing it with the data team.
# The poller authenticates to the drop host with the credential set on
# the next line:

env line for fafof-fahag: LEDGER_TOKEN5=f8790

## Deploying the Gatewick Proctor Queue

Deploys are pretty painless: push to main, wait for the pipeline, then watch the queue drain dashboard for five minutes. If candidates pile up mid-exam, roll back first and ask questions later — the queue replays safely. Everything the workers care about lives in one config block, shown here for reference.

settings of bafof-yagef:
JOROX_PIN=8740
JOROX_TENANT=pelox
JOROX_METRICS_HOST=metrics.jorox.qorvelworks.internal
JOROX_SEAL=seal_c78f63c1
JOROX_STANDBY_TEAM=norax

- [ ] Key ceremony step 7: Before sealing the signing key for the Farewagon rules engine (shipping-fee tier logic), confirm both witnesses have verified the checksum of the rules bundle against the tagged release. Reviewer must countersign the ceremony log. The recovery passphrase to be escrowed is recorded directly below this line.

unlock words, tagaf-hahif: ralwyn-lammir-rusax-sormir

**Step 7 — Dedup key escrow (MergeWell ceremony)**

Before activating the customer-record deduplication run, confirm both custodians have verified the matching-rule hash aloud and signed the ceremony log. The escrow account that holds the merge-authorization key must remain offline except during this step. For the reviewer's record, its recovery passphrase is escrowed immediately below.

unlock words, kahif-bajep: druix-sormir-fenys